Let the first number equal x and the second number equal y. You have: A) x + y = 89. B) 4x + y = 155. First you rearrange equation A to obtain equation C) y = 89 - x Then substitute C) into B) to obtain equation D) 4x + 89 - x = 155 Solve equation D) for x to obtain x = 22. Place the value of x in equation C) to obtain y = 67. Thus your answer is {x = 22, y = 67}.
